WebOct 21, 2024 · Exuberance sounds like a good thing, but bankers say it with caution. They’re always on the lookout for when markets become “overly exuberant.” That’s code for when buyers decide to pay a premium on a commodity, … WebIrrational Exuberance. A term used by Alan Greenspan in 1996 to describe the dot-com bubble and, more broadly, the fact that the markets were overvalued. WebNov 17, 2024 · Irrational Exuberance Investing Definition. In investing, irrational exuberance is when investor confidence drives asset prices higher than their fundamentals logically justify. This is more than just a marginal rise.
